What is Touchscreen Technology?
In Touchless Touchscreen the there is no physical contact between the user and the device It works by detecting hand movements in front of it.
Technology behind this
This is based on optical pattern recognition using a solid state optical matrix sensor
Optical matrix sensor
This sensor is then connected to a digital image processor, which interprets the patterns of motion and outputs the results as signals
Optical Matrix Sensor In each of these sensors there is a matrix of pixels Each pixel is coupled to photodiodes incorporating charge storage regions.
